Crime Prevention Unit

The following programs are operated through the Community Relations Division.


The main objective of the Crime Prevention Unit is to reduce the opportunity for crime, thereby reducing the likelihood that crime will occur. The Crime Prevention Unit is committed to the development and implementation of comprehensive proactive programs, procedures that anticipates, recognizes, and assesses crime risks, and which initiate actions to remove or reduce those crime risks. Although crime prevention is a fundamental responsibility of every departmental employee, the Crime Prevention Unit is specifically charged with the responsibilities of planning and coordinating events and programs to inform, educate, and assist citizens in becoming more crime prevention / crime reduction oriented.

Home Security Survey


CRIME PREVENTION THROUGH ENVIRONMENTAL DESIGN

The following suggestions are made for the purpose of reducing the likelihood of criminal activity. While no guarantee can be stated or implied, the concepts of C.P.T.E.D. have proven themselves internationally. The Long Beach Police Department offers the inspection as a public service, with the understanding that there is no way to predict or prevent all crime risks. The purpose of this inspection is to reduce the potential for crime, by making a good faith effort to provide a safe environment.
